What types of metal fabrication services does MK2 offer?
MK2 Fabrication provides full-service metal fabrication, including CNC laser cutting, press brake forming, welding, sheet metal assemblies, and custom production parts. We specialize in built-to-print projects for manufacturers, construction suppliers, and regional businesses within a 200-mile radius of Clarkrange, TN.

What tolerances and precision can MK2 achieve?
MK2 Fabrication holds sheet metal tolerances to ±.003 inches, ensuring high-precision components for critical applications. Our CNC laser, press brake forming, and welding operations maintain consistent quality across custom and repeatable production runs.

How quickly can MK2 deliver custom metal fabrication projects?
MK2 Fabrication specializes in fast turnaround without sacrificing quality. Small sheet metal jobs typically ship in 2–4 days, while larger or more complex projects are generally completed within 1–2 weeks. By combining lean operations, CNC automation, and an agile workflow, we help regional businesses reduce lead times and get products to market faster.
